What is the basic structure of a cell membrane?
Phospholipids form the basic structure of a cell membrane, called the lipid bilayer. Scattered in the lipid bilayer are cholesterol molecules, which help to keep the membrane fluid consistent. Membrane proteins are important for transporting substances across the cell membrane.
Which model best explains the plasma membrane structure?
The fluid mosaic model was first proposed by S.J. Singer and Garth L. Nicolson in 1972 to explain the structure of the plasma membrane. The model has evolved somewhat over time, but it still best accounts for the structure and functions of the plasma membrane as we now understand them.

Why is cell membrane called plasma membrane?
II The Bimolecular Lipid Membrane. The term plasma membrane derives from the German Plasmamembran, a word coined by Karl Wilhelm Nägeli (1817–1891) to describe the firm film that forms when the proteinaceous sap of an injured cell comes into contact with water.

What is the fundamental structure of the plasma membrane?
The fundamental structure of the membrane is the phospholipid bilayer, which forms a stable barrier between two aqueous compartments. In the case of the plasma membrane, these compartments are the inside and the outside of the cell.

How do Phospholipids make the plasma membrane look like?
Each phospholipid molecule has a water-soluble polar head and two fat-soluble non-polar tails. Top head of phospholipids is hydrophilic while tail end is hydrophobic. The phospholipid layer also contains protein and cholesterol. They make the plasma membrane look like a mosaic. Chemically, the second major component of plasma membranes is proteins.
